Edition 2025 — Isola di Culture

The first edition of Isola di Culture took place from August 30 to September 3, 2025, at the Municipal Theatre of Ustica. Five evenings of free admission featuring civic theatre, tradition, and music, organised by the Municipality of Ustica and CoopCulture with the Collettivo Genìa and the Kangaroo association, closed the island's summer with stories of resistance, memory, and Sicilian song.

The first edition (2025)

From August 30 to September 3, 2025, the Municipal Theatre of Ustica hosted the first edition of Isola di Culture, five evenings dedicated to civic theatre, folk roots, and musical experimentation. The programme opened on Saturday, August 30, with "… dove le stesse mani", a theatrical story about a man killed by mistake by the mafia (directed by Dario Mangiaracina and Dario Muratore), followed on the second evening by "Oltre il sole e la luna c'è le stelle", a clandestine recital dedicated to Danilo Dolci with Ugo Giacomazzi and Luigi Di Gangi.

On Monday, September 1, the album "Ancora più buio" by Angelo Sicurella was presented; on September 2, the festival continued with "Sulis e Spitaleri", an encounter between the percussion of Dario Sulis and the piano of Diego Spitaleri, and with "Rosa cunta e canta", a tribute to Rosa Balistreri performed by Donatella Finocchiaro. Admission to all performances was free.
